Marta Sánchez Borràs – Project Manager of CENIT

Dr.-Eng. Marta Sánchez-Borràs holds a PhD with a European Mention from the Technical University of Catalonia (UPC – Universitat Politècnica de Catalunya), a master’s degree in Civil Engineering from the UPC, a master’s degree in Civil Engineering and Urban Planning from the Institut National des Sciences Appliquées (INSA de Lyon, France), and the Euforia’s Certification, awarded to engineers with a solid education in science and economics, fluent in three foreign languages and having carried out academic and/or professional stays in three different countries. She joined CENIT in February 2005, after having been working as a trainee engineer in different companies within the transport and urban planning sectors (FGC, 22@bcn, CLABSA, STAEDLER-Nuremberg). In 2008 she attended the Institute for Transport Studies (ITS) of the University of Leeds, under the supervision of Prof. Chris Nash, within the framework of her PhD Thesis on the impact of rail infrastructure charging systems implemented in Europe on the competitiveness of high speed services, published by EurailPress, from the DVV Media Group. Since September 2009 she is assistant lecturer at the Department of Transport Infrastructure and Territory of the School of Civil Engineering of Barcelona (UPC) and lecturer of several professional and official master’s degrees organized by UPC.

Her research lines include:

  • Railway transport and high speed railways.
  • Railway infrastructure pricing.
  • Mobility planning & management.
